Association Between Total Cell Free DNA and SARS-CoV-2 In Kidney Transplant Patients: A Preliminary Study.

Jose Otto Reusing1, Jongwon Yoo2, Amishi Desai2

  • 1Renal Transplant Service, Hospital das Clinicas, University of São Paulo School of Medicine, São Paulo, Brazil.

Transplantation Proceedings
|May 26, 2022
PubMed
Summary

Elevated cell-free DNA (cfDNA) in kidney transplant recipients with COVID-19 may mask rejection. Monitoring total cfDNA is crucial for accurate donor-derived cfDNA (dd-cfDNA) interpretation during infection.

Area of Science:

  • Nephrology
  • Transplant Immunology
  • Infectious Diseases

Background:

  • Kidney transplant (KT) recipients face severe COVID-19 risks.
  • Lowering immunosuppression aids immune response but risks rejection.
  • Donor-derived cell-free DNA (dd-cfDNA) detects KT rejection.

Purpose of the Study:

  • Investigate total and dd-cfDNA levels in KT recipients with COVID-19.
  • Assess the impact of infection on dd-cfDNA as a rejection biomarker.

Main Methods:

  • Retrospective analysis of 29 KT recipients hospitalized with COVID-19.
  • Measured total and dd-cfDNA levels post-infection onset and during recovery.

Main Results:

  • Total cfDNA levels were elevated during COVID-19 (median 7.9 MoM), decreasing post-infection.
  • Higher total cfDNA correlated with COVID-19 severity.
  • Two rejections were missed due to low dd-cfDNA fractions (<1%) amid high total cfDNA.

Conclusions:

  • Elevated total cfDNA in infected KT patients can obscure dd-cfDNA results.
  • Accurate rejection assessment requires considering total cfDNA levels.
  • Total cfDNA monitoring is vital for interpreting dd-cfDNA in infected KT recipients.
